McCreath's Lookahead: SNC scandal remains in the spotlight During the next three months, in response to requests from prosecutors, SNC-Lavalin provides detailed information it sees as making a strong case for an agreement. Spring - Although the bill has yet to pass, SNC-Lavalin contacts Public Prosecution Service lawyers to ensure they have all relevant information for a possible invitation to negotiate a remediation agreement. SNC-Lavalin had lobbied for such a provision in Canadian law. ![]() March 27 - The Liberals table a budget bill that includes a change to the Criminal Code allowing "remediation agreements," plea-bargain-like deals between prosecutors and accused corporations in which they can avoid criminal proceedings by making reparations for previous bad behaviour. She is the first Indigenous person to hold the post, which combines duties as a politician (heading the Department of Justice) and a legal official (overseeing prosecutions). Two weeks later, Prime Minister Justin Trudeau names Jody Wilson-Raybould minister of justice and attorney general of Canada. 19 - The Liberals win a federal election, taking power from the Conservatives. SNC-Lavalin says the charges are without merit and stem from "alleged reprehensible deeds by former employees who left the company long ago." A conviction could bar the company from bidding on Canadian government business, potentially devastating it. 19 - The RCMP lays corruption and fraud charges against Montreal-based engineering and construction firm SNC-Lavalin, over allegations it used bribery to get government business in Libya.
